Who Is Alys Rivers in House of the Dragon and Fire & Blood?

House of the Dragon season 3 has brought the spotlight back to one of the most intriguing characters in the franchise, Alys Rivers. Rivers was introduced in Season 2 as the mysterious woman living at Harrenhal. She eventually became a source of intrigue for her cryptic visions, uncanny knowledge and strange connection to Daemon Targaryen.
Even though HBO barely revealed anything about her, George R.R. Martin's ‘Fire & Blood’ paints a more complex, and at times contradictory, picture of who she is. She is a healer and caretaker who first met with Daemon Targaryen as he arrived at the cursed castle. She then gets caught up in his psychological journey.
Additionally, she also influences several key moments in Daemon's arc through visions, dreams, and cryptic warnings. Meanwhile, she is even more mysterious in the book. The fictional historians of ‘Fire & Blood’ record different versions, saying that Rivers was a bastard of House Strong. The book also asserts that Rivers had prophetic powers and supposedly saw visions in flames, pools of water and storm clouds.
Her greatest impact, however, comes through her strange connection with Daemon Targaryen.
Inside Alys Rivers' Connection to Daemon Targaryen
Alys Rivers is important, even if she does not show up that much. She is the mystical side of George R.R. Martin's world, in both the book and the series. Her relationship with Daemon Targaryen in the show has already altered her role from the books, making her one of the biggest wild cards going into Season 3.

Rivers also pops up several times at crucial moments during his time at Harrenhal. She led him through disturbing visions, confronting him with guilt, ambition, and his complicated legacy. In Fire & Blood, Daemon and Alys did not have a huge connection, but the show has expanded their interactions quite a bit. Now, it is to see if she is a gifted seer, a master manipulator, or something far more supernatural.
